Abstract

This study analyzes a newly developed measure for assessing the knowledge of general
academic vocabulary in upper-elementary school students in Croatia. This researcherdesigned
instrument assesses students’ command of synonymy and the limits of
collocational use as a proxy for academic vocabulary breadth and depth. Elementary
school students in the 5th, 6th, and 7th grade participated in the study (N = 152, 69,7%
girls). In addition to the newly developed measure for assessing general academic
vocabulary, students completed the Mill Hill Vocabulary Scales, a standardized
measure of general vocabulary knowledge. The results show that the newly developed
instrument for measuring general academic vocabulary knowledge is reliable and
valid—it has adequate internal consistency, is sensitive to the expected age and
gender differences in vocabulary, and correlates highly with the results obtained by
the Mill Hill Vocabulary Scales. This new instrument could fill the gap in academic
vocabulary-related research since the currently available vocabulary assessment
measures in Croatian do not focus on this particular register. More specifically,
our new measure could be used to evaluate various types of academic vocabulary
interventions in schools.
